D-Wave Systematically Rebuts Flatiron Claims, Reaffirming Beyond-Classical Simulation Milestones
D-Wave Quantum Inc. (NYSE: QBTS) has issued a detailed corporate and technical response defending its previously claimed benchmarks of “beyond-classical” quantum computational simulation supremacy. The statement addresses recent coverage surrounding the Flatiron Institute’s newly published Science manuscript on multi-dimensional tensor networks, which suggested that classical workstations could replicate physical quantum annealing state calculations. D-Wave directly refutes the premise that its 2025 milestones have been overturned or nullified, asserting that the classical framework fails to scale across the most complex problem classes, configurations, and physical measurements native to the original physical hardware demonstration.
